Beautiful Sibia
The Beautiful Sibia is an attractive bird of the forest undergrowth and montane forests of the eastern Himalayas through to southwestern China and Myanmar. It has chestnut-brown upperparts, grey underparts, and a distinctive long tail with a blue-grey gloss. It is gregarious and feeds on insects, berries, and nectar in dense forest.
